| 查看: 774 | 回复: 4 | |||
[交流]
【求助】求解常微分方程出现警告,求助
|
|
求解如下微分方程时,出现警告 Warning: Failure at t=4.893789e-005. Unable to meet integration tolerances without reducing the step size below the smallest value allowed (1.738623e-019) at time t. 无法得到要求的解区间,请帮忙分析一下。 Y0=[0.0001; 15.2571]; tspan=[0.4894e-4 0]; [t,YY]=ode23s('DYdt',tspan,Y0); plot(YY(:,1),t) function Yd=DYdt(t,Y) Yd=[Y(2); (1+Y(2)^2)/Y(1)+ 9.4597e+008*(1+Y(2)^2)^1.5]; |
» 猜你喜欢
290调剂生物0860
已经有5人回复
359求调剂
已经有3人回复
求调剂,985材料与化工348分
已经有5人回复
211本科材料化工求调剂
已经有9人回复
材料考研调剂
已经有24人回复
366求调剂
已经有5人回复
求调剂,一志愿大连理工大学354分
已经有5人回复
308求调剂
已经有3人回复
266求调剂,一志愿哈工程电子信息,本科获多项国奖和省奖
已经有7人回复
求调剂
已经有12人回复
» 本主题相关价值贴推荐,对您同样有帮助:
求解二阶非线性常微分方程!!!解决之后另有重谢!!!
已经有5人回复
哪位高手可以帮我解答,常微分方程,解的延拓课后习题求解
已经有11人回复
求解二阶变系数常微分方程
已经有7人回复
求助非线性常微分方程和常系数双曲偏微分方程求解
已经有7人回复
常微分方程求解公式
已经有7人回复
求解方程,在线等……求大神指点!
已经有7人回复
Matlab数值求解二阶常微分方程
已经有9人回复
Matlab数值求解非线性常微分方程
已经有5人回复
求助,matlab求解二元二阶的常微分方程组
已经有9人回复
求助ANSYS求解总是警告
已经有6人回复
一个二阶常微分方程的求解方法?
已经有5人回复
matlab求解常微分方程
已经有6人回复
二阶常微分方程求解
已经有5人回复
1stopt4阶非线性常微分方程,帮小弟看一下,跪求。
已经有7人回复
高手进来用matlab求解常微分方程,十分感谢!
已经有17人回复
隐式欧拉法求解一阶常微分方程
已经有7人回复
1stOpt求解常微分方程边值问题
已经有5人回复
matlab 求解隐式常微分方程时用ode15i 函数出现的问题求助
已经有3人回复
【求助】ansys求解时出现警告:有4个小支点调解方程求解,原因是?
已经有3人回复
【求助】出现以下警告一般是哪些设置出现了问题?
已经有4人回复
【求助】常微分方程组求解中系数与某变量值关联的问题
已经有12人回复
【求助】如何用Runge-Kutta迭代求解二阶常微分方程组【已解决】
已经有9人回复
» 抢金币啦!回帖就可以得到:
征位互相欣赏、双向奔赴、同甘共苦、安度余生的伴侣
+1/75
上海应用技术大学刘敏课题组招生---欢迎材料,物理和化学相关背景
+1/46
欢迎调剂到江西水利电力大学理学院能源动力(储能技术)硕士研究生
+1/39
齐鲁工业大学轻工学部曹珊副教授接收硕士调剂1人
+1/38
滁州学院生物与食品工程学院还有调剂名额,调剂系统4.11日起开放
+1/38
喀什大学环境生态修复功能材料与技术团队接收2026年调剂研究生
+1/34
上海应用技术大学姚子建课题组招生,大学ip上海,点击就送研究生学历
+1/20
药物化学、材料与化工专业还有大量名额,速报名!!!
+1/12
大连大学-贵州省煤炭洁净利用重点实验室联合培养研究生 化学5人+环境工程7人
+1/12
河南农大刘立杰课题组招收化学、材料与化工调剂生开放时间10日17点-11日9点
+1/8
福建农林大学资环学院李香真-姚敏杰教授课题组招收硕士调剂生
+1/7
江苏海洋大学+环境与化学工程学院+课题组招调剂生+第一批调剂
+2/6
【2026考研调剂学子看过来,关注南昌航空大学高性价比一本高校】
+1/6
齐齐哈尔大学李莉课题组诚招2026级考研调剂生(学硕和专硕)
+1/5
江西水利电力大学土木水利第二轮调剂系统已开
+1/4
长安大学智能爆破课题组招收2026级博士和硕士研究生
+1/2
沈阳工业大学-环境科学与工程083000调剂-学硕
+1/2
南阳师范学院化学、制药工程专业接受07/08/09/1406开头专业硕士招生调剂
+1/2
武汉纺织大学材料学院姜伟杰青团队招生
+1/1
安徽工程大学化学与环境工程学院2026级硕士研究生还有部分调剂名额-资源与环境专硕
+1/1
2楼2011-03-11 15:55:53
3楼2011-03-14 09:07:47
★ ★
xiegangmai(金币+2): 谢谢应助! 2011-03-14 12:37:04
micronano(金币+5): 2011-03-14 16:35:29
xiegangmai(金币+2): 谢谢应助! 2011-03-14 12:37:04
micronano(金币+5): 2011-03-14 16:35:29
|
我也不知道你那常微分方程组写得对不对?再核实下。 按照你的方程组形式和初始条件帮你简化了下,两三行就可以解决问题了。 --------------------------------------------------------------------------------------------------- function main fun = @(t,Y)[Y(2);(1+Y(2)^2)/Y(1)+9.4597e+08*(1+Y(2)^2)^1.5]; [t,Y] = ode45(fun,[0.4894e-4 0],[0.0001 15.2571]); plot(Y(:,1),Y(:,2)) --------------------------------------------------------------------------------------------------- 但结果同样遇到问题Warning: Failure at t=4.893789e-005. Unable to meet integration tolerances without reducing the step size below the smallest value allowed (1.738623e-019) at time t. ------------------------------------------- 分析: 1. 按提示需要减小step size 2. 检查你的方程和初值条件,如果都没问题,那么即使warning提示,也不表示一定是错误 |
4楼2011-03-14 10:01:32
5楼2011-03-14 10:13:04













回复此楼